Pamela Anderson

Pamela Anderson is a Canadian-American actress, model, and media personality who rose to fame as Playboy's February 1990 Playmate of the Month, eventually holding the record for most Playboy covers. She gained wider recognition for her roles on the sitcom Home Improvement (1991-1993) and, most notably, as C.J. Parker on the action drama Baywatch (1992-1997), solidifying her image as a sex symbol. In 1995, controversy arose when a stolen sex tape featuring Anderson and her then-husband, Tommy Lee, was released, leading to legal battles and further public scrutiny.

1989: Moved to California

In 1989, Pamela Anderson moved to California.

1994: Turns down role in Naked Gun 33 1/3

In 1994, Pamela Anderson was offered the role of Tanya Peters in the film Naked Gun 33 1/3: The Final Insult, but turned it down due to scheduling conflicts.

February 19, 1995: Marriage to Tommy Lee

On February 19, 1995, Pamela Anderson married Tommy Lee, the drummer of Mötley Crüe, after knowing him for only four days. The wedding took place on a beach.

1995: Stealing and splicing of personal home videos

In 1995, personal home videos of Pamela Anderson and her then-husband Tommy Lee were stolen and spliced together. The videos were recorded on a houseboat on Lake Mead.

1996: Birth of son Brandon Thomas

In 1996, Pamela Anderson had her first son with Tommy Lee, named Brandon Thomas.

November 1997: Lawsuit against Internet Entertainment Group

In November 1997, Pamela Anderson sued the video distribution company, Internet Entertainment Group, who posted her stolen sex tape on their website ClubLove.

1997: Birth of son Dylan Jagger

In 1997, Pamela Anderson had her second son with Tommy Lee, named Dylan Jagger.

1998: Divorce from Tommy Lee

Pamela Anderson and Tommy Lee divorced in 1998 after he was sentenced to six months in the Los Angeles County Jail for spousal abuse.

2001: Purchased Malibu Beach Home

In 2001, Pamela Anderson purchased a beach home in Malibu, California for $1.8 million.

March 2002: Public statement about hepatitis C

In March 2002, Pamela Anderson publicly stated that she had contracted hepatitis C by sharing tattoo needles with Tommy Lee and began writing a regular column for Jane magazine.

October 2002: Joint custody of sons

In October 2002, Pamela Anderson and Tommy Lee finalized a long custody dispute over their sons and were granted joint custody.

October 2003: Statement on Howard Stern's radio show

In October 2003, Pamela Anderson jokingly said on Howard Stern's radio show that she did not expect to live more than 10 or 15 years. This statement was taken seriously by various websites and tabloids.

2004: Became a Naturalized US Citizen

In 2004, Pamela Anderson became a naturalized citizen of the United States while retaining her Canadian citizenship.

March 2005: Spokesperson for MAC AIDS Fund

In March 2005, Pamela Anderson became a spokesperson for MAC Cosmetics's MAC AIDS Fund, which helped people affected by AIDS and HIV.

September 2007: Engagement announcement

In September 2007, Pamela Anderson stated on The Ellen DeGeneres Show that she was engaged to Rick Salomon.

October 6, 2007: Marriage to Rick Salomon

On October 6, 2007, Pamela Anderson married Rick Salomon in a small wedding ceremony at The Mirage, between her two nightly appearances at the Planet Hollywood Resort and Casino in Hans Klok's magic show.

February 22, 2008: Request for annulment

On February 22, 2008, Pamela Anderson requested through the courts that her marriage to Rick Salomon be annulled, citing fraud.

2008: Interest in Moving to Finland

In 2008, Pamela Anderson considered moving to Finland and opening a strip club called "Lapland" due to her Finnish ancestry.

2009: Advocates for Legalization of Cannabis

In 2009, Pamela Anderson wrote an open letter to President Barack Obama urging the legalization of cannabis.

2010: PETA Ad Banned

In 2010, Pamela Anderson posed for a PETA ad wearing a bikini with sections drawn on her body like meat cuts, with the tagline "All Animals Have the Same Parts". The ad was banned in Montreal, Quebec, on the grounds that it was sexist.

2012: Company Spokesperson for FrogAds, Inc.

In 2012, Pamela Anderson became a company spokesperson for FrogAds, Inc., which used her in a media campaign for a pool operation without her knowledge.

October 2013: "Friends with benefits" statement

In October 2013, Pamela Anderson stated on The Ellen DeGeneres Show that she and Rick Salomon were "friends with benefits".

2013: Attempted to Sell Malibu Beach Home

In 2013, Pamela Anderson attempted to sell her Malibu home for $7.75 million but later took it off the market.

January 2014: Remarriage to Rick Salomon announced

In January 2014, Pamela Anderson announced that she had remarried Rick Salomon on an unspecified date.

February 2014: Valentine's Day PETA Ad

In February 2014, Pamela Anderson stripped for a Valentine's Day-themed ad for PETA, urging dog lovers to cuddle with their pets during winter.

2014: Rolling Stone article

In 2014, an article was published by Rolling Stone, the rights to which were later optioned for the production of the Hulu miniseries Pam & Tommy without Pamela Anderson's participation, permission, or consent.

February 2015: Filing for divorce from Rick Salomon

In February 2015, Pamela Anderson filed for divorce from Rick Salomon.

April 29, 2015: Divorce from Rick Salomon finalized

On April 29, 2015, Pamela Anderson's divorce from Rick Salomon was finalized.

July 8, 2015: Letter to Vladimir Putin

On July 8, 2015, Pamela Anderson wrote to Vladimir Putin to save whales.

December 15, 2015: Met with Kremlin Officials Regarding Animal Rights

On December 15, 2015, Pamela Anderson, representing the International Fund for Animal Welfare (IFAW), met with top Kremlin officials regarding animals rights in Russia.

December 2015: Sea Shepherd Board Member

In December 2015, Pamela Anderson became a full board member of the Sea Shepherd Conservation Society to further its efforts in opposing whale hunting.

2015: Cured of hepatitis C

By 2015, Pamela Anderson had been cured of hepatitis C.

November 2016: Stars in Ride Responsibly PSA

In November 2016, Pamela Anderson starred in a video public service announcement for the Ride Responsibly initiative, titled The Driving Game, to shed light on driver regulations.

December 15, 2016: Meeting with Kremlin Officials

On December 15, 2016, Pamela Anderson and IFAW officials met with Kremlin officials to discuss animal welfare and conservation.

December 2016: Defends Julian Assange

In December 2016, Pamela Anderson called WikiLeaks founder Julian Assange a "hero", stating he had done everyone "a great service".

2016: Co-Authors Opinion Article on Pornography

In 2016, Pamela Anderson co-authored an opinion article in The Wall Street Journal with Orthodox rabbi Shmuley Boteach, calling online pornography a "public hazard of unprecedented seriousness."

2017: Relationship with Adil Rami began

In 2017, Pamela Anderson started a relationship with French soccer player Adil Rami.

January 2018: Stars in Ride Responsibly PSA

In January 2018, Pamela Anderson starred in a video public service announcement for the Ride Responsibly initiative, titled The Signs, pushing for passenger safety and driver regulations.

2018: Release of Lust for Love

In 2018, Pamela Anderson and Shmuley Boteach released their book Lust for Love, about meaningful sex and relationships.

2018: Referenced Disparaging Remarks

In October 2019, Pamela Anderson referenced the disparaging remarks Australian Prime Minister Scott Morrison made about her in 2018 and challenged him to debate the matter.

April 2019: Anger at Assange's Expulsion

In April 2019, Pamela Anderson expressed anger on Twitter at Julian Assange's expulsion from Ecuador's London embassy.

May 2019: Visit to Assange in Belmarsh Prison

In May 2019, Pamela Anderson visited Julian Assange in Belmarsh prison with Kristinn Hrafnsson and expressed her love and support for him.

October 2019: Challenges Australian Prime Minister

In October 2019, Pamela Anderson announced she would be traveling to Australia in November to challenge Australian Prime Minister Scott Morrison to stand up for Julian Assange.

November 2019: Travels to Australia to Challenge Prime Minister

In November 2019, Pamela Anderson planned to travel to Australia to challenge Prime Minister Scott Morrison regarding Julian Assange's situation.

2019: Relationship with Adil Rami ended

In 2019, Pamela Anderson's relationship with French soccer player Adil Rami ended.

2019: Involved with European Spring

In 2019, after supporting the yellow vests movement, Pamela Anderson attended a meeting of the European Spring with Yanis Varoufakis and Benoît Hamon and appeared on election posters of the German DiEM25 campaign.

2019: Endorses Green Party of Canada

In the 2019 Canadian federal election, Pamela Anderson endorsed the Green Party of Canada.

2019: Last Performance Before Broadway

Pamela Anderson's appearance in the Broadway production of Chicago in 2022 marked her first performance since 2019.

December 24, 2020: Marriage to Dan Hayhurst

On December 24, 2020, Pamela Anderson married Dan Hayhurst, who was her bodyguard.

January 18, 2021: Asks Trump to pardon Assange

On January 18, 2021, Pamela Anderson spoke on Tucker Carlson Tonight, asking President Donald Trump to pardon Julian Assange.

January 21, 2022: Filing for divorce from Dan Hayhurst

On January 21, 2022, Pamela Anderson announced that she had filed for divorce and split with Dan Hayhurst.

April 12, 2022: Broadway Debut in Chicago

On April 12, 2022, Pamela Anderson made her Broadway debut, playing Roxie Hart in the Broadway production of Chicago.

June 5, 2022: Final Performance in Chicago

On June 5, 2022, Pamela Anderson concluded her eight-week run as Roxie Hart in the Broadway production of Chicago.

2022: Release of "Pam & Tommy" miniseries

In 2022, the Hulu miniseries Pam & Tommy, which portrayed the story of the stolen sex tape, was released. Pamela Anderson stated she was not consulted about the production of the series.
